Tent only campground with wooded sites along a beautiful creek, very quiet. Good spacing between sites, with picnic tables and fire rings. There are only pit toilets nearby. Surprisingly, I had good internet service (AT&T).

CAMPERS BEWARE!!

This is a very beautiful campground!! Very peaceful and the staff are very friendly. We stayed at Blue Jay tent site 3. The reason for the warning is that if you visit Campbell falls, BEWARE it is extremely slippery. The brown algae makes it very slick and no shoe will handle it. There’s no real entrance to the water to swim. We literally had to slide down like a water slide haha. But when we got down there the water was freezing cold and we had to get out which was very very difficult. There is only a STEEP bank. This is the same way for Mash Creek Falls, the rocks are extremely slippery. Ankle breaker rocks. Make sure to come early also to visit the mash fork creek campground office to get your firewood! The nearest store is very far. We had to go all the way to Tractor supply in Beckley because we came too late. Also visit the marsh creek bathrooms for showers! Like I said it’s gorgeous here and especially when it’s a breezy day. The walk down to the creek behind our campsite is very easy and only a few steps. Have fun!!

HIGHLY RECOMMEND SANDSTONE FALLS!! Not too far of a drive and very very worth it!! Easy handicap accessible boardwalk. That is my last pic and video!
